A Place To Bury Strangers Sign to Dead Oceans
Posted by Lyssa on October 11th, 2011
Dead Oceans is thrilled to announce that A Place To Bury Strangers are the latest addition to our label family. Having put on numerous wild shows across the US and Europe — their recent Rocksoff Cruise included band members tossing plugged in amps overboard — APTBS’ ferocious live performances have won over a wide range of audiences. Their solid wall of sound is built meticulously, brick by brick, to form a cohesive all-encompassing experience: physical, intellectual, emotional.
Label co-founder Phil Waldorf says, “I’ve been enamored with A Place to Bury Strangers since I first heard their debut album. Their live shows have rattled me time and time again. It is not often you get to work with a band that you’ve been closely following for years, and we are honored to be a part of their new chapter. Wait until you hear what comes next.”
The trio has been hard at work on a new set of 5 songs, which will be released on Dead Oceans as an EP in early 2012. More details on the new EP and tour dates will follow soon.
